Our Spanish courses are specially designed for foreign students, covering all aspects of learning a new language. Our flexibility, enthusiasm and communication-orientated classes ensure that you will be totally immersed in the Argentine way of life.
Methodology: Learning a language means acquiring the necessary knowledge and skills to communicate effectively in different situations. That is why COINED classes are student-centered based on the learner’s experience. As a result, our students gain communicative and social skills while being immersed in the local culture.
Variety of Courses: Each course is divided into 6 levels: Beginner I and II, Intermediate I and II, Advance and Superior, you will be placed in the right level according to your knowledge of Spanish. You decide the length of the course.
International Certificates: COINED also offers preparatory courses for the DELE exams, the official qualifications certifying levels of competence in the Spanish language, granted by the Spanish Ministry of Education Culture and Sport.
Classes: 55-minutes lessons are held every day from Monday to Friday by highly professional and extremely experienced teachers. A maximum of seven students per class.
College Credit: Students can obtain credits in several colleges and universities by contacting the corresponding Admission Office, Study Abroad Office or Spanish Department before applying to COINED.
Cultural Activities: A minimum of 3 recreational activities are organized per week making our program an immersion experience in the local culture.
